ELF>`#@X@8 @00 GGpppllp $$Std Ptdzzz  QtdRtdPPGNUGNUbX$!#K{_A$$ZϷ` Fp}{U)`M +S<, e9F"`g~__gmon_start___ITM_deregisterTMCloneTable_ITM_registerTMCloneTable__cxa_finalizePyErr_SetString_PyArg_ParseStack_SizeTPyBytes_FromStringAndSizePyBytes_AsStringPyBuffer_Release__stack_chk_failPyExc_MemoryError_Py_NoneStruct_PyArg_ParseTuple_SizeT_Py_BuildValue_SizeTPyExc_ValueErrorPyExc_TypeErrorPyMem_MallocPyTuple_TypePyTuple_SizePyTuple_GetItemPyMem_FreePyErr_NoMemoryPyExc_OverflowErrorPyTuple_NewPyTuple_SetItemPyErr_OccurredPyLong_FromLongPyLong_FromSsize_tPyFloat_FromDoublePyLong_FromUnsignedLongsqrtPyInit_audioopPyModule_Create2PyModule_GetDictPyErr_NewExceptionPyDict_SetItemStringlibm.so.6libpython3.7m.so.1.0libc.so.6GLIBC_2.2.5GLIBC_2.4/opt/alt/python37/lib:/opt/alt/sqlite/usr/lib/x86_64-linux-gnuu ui ui ii $#hrrȮ fخ@rX` r(c8`@rH aX`rh`_xp:`.r\`Yrȯ]د$rZr@U@ q(PR8@pH 1X `php/x}p-pp+cpȰ)ذWp'p6 p(28@qHMX`qhIx@qpHJp%=pȱ$ر Sqp? ȟ П ؟# (08@H P X`hpxȠ Р!ؠ"HHHtH5%hhhhhhhhqhah Qh Ah 1h !h hhhhhhhhhhqha%-~D%=~D%5~D%-~D%%~D%~D%~D% ~D%~D%}D%}D%}D%}D%}D%}D%}D%}D%}D%}D%}D%}D%}D%}D%}D%}D%}}DH=HH9tH6|Ht H=H5H)HH?HHHtH5|HtfD=Eu+UH=|Ht H=|d]wHH=H5K1HfUHSHcލCHwHHHHu%H[]tHHHHtH=H5KH1[]ff.ATfHHUHqKSHpdH%(HD$h1Hl$LD$ )D$H)D$ )D$0)D$@)D$P8\$ H|$ t|Ht$ 1IHthHH|$ ~[HcDC1HOHt8L)Hȅ~)H L VLL\$MI)HGDQL9uHH;T$ | E1H|$tH=HD$hdH3%(u HpL[]A\Lff.AVfHHATHMJUSHxdH%(HD$h1Hl$LD$ )D$H)D$ )D$0)D$@)D$PDt$ H|$ DHt$ 1IHtpHxHT$ H~aMcE10fDA~AHы7L)L)4ML9~)LT$K<AuHL)ˆ HT$ E1H|$tHHD$hdH3%(uwHxL[]A\A^7HL)ftCLCL7HL)ƈLHT$ L)ˆlHT$ L)ˆLHT$ 8AWfHHAVHHAUATUSHxdH%(HD$h1Hl$LL$ )D$LD$H)D$ )D$0)D$@)D$P]\$H|$ Dd$ @AD$HD$ LcMcHIHHHIH9I1IHHH|$ E1DAt=AAMLL;T$ }NLD$K<uAuf.HvH5IH8:f.E1H|$tHHD$hdH3%(HxL[]A\A]A^A_f]D1DCTCT7 Dֈ0P@p f{iNifAUfHHATHFUSHxdH%(HD$h1Hl$LD$ )D$H)D$ )D$0)D$@)D$P&Dd$ H|$ D HD$ Ic1HHHIHHH|$ LL$1H=oOM1AtzDAAAHAAЅy AAU1ɺOfD9}nHHuADHHH;t$ }LL$M1AuAfE1H|$tHHD$hdH3%(HxL[]A\A]AA~EAAE E1{fADƒD AfDA@AT1AT1A_ff.@AUfHHATHDUSHxdH%(HD$h1Hl$LD$ )D$H)D$ )D$0)D$@)D$P\$ CHLcHt$ HIH9I1IHHoHT$ Ht$IH~m1H=CI'HT$ LIH9};HWuHrH5EH82E1H|$tHHD$hdH3%(uKHxL[]A\A]Ð뿐fi@AATDDIff.@AUfHHATHBUSHxdH%(HD$h1Hl$LD$ )D$H)D$ )D$0)D$@)D$PfDd$ H|$ DLHD$ Ic1HHHIHHH|$ LL$1H=KM1At~DAAAHAyA!E1A? @FODfA9}rIIuAD@HH;t$ }!LL$M1AuAfDE1H|$tHHD$hdH3%(uiHxL[]A\A]҃AD A1fA+@AT1AT1AAUfHHATH@USHxdH%(HD$h1Hl$LD$ )D$H)D$ )D$0)D$@)D$Pv\$ CHLcHt$ HIH9I1IHHHT$ Ht$IH~m1H=G'HT$ LIH9};HWuH1oH5*BH8E1H|$tH?HD$hdH3%(uKHxL[]A\A]ÐK뿐fi@AATDDIff.@AUfHHATHZ?USHxdH%(HD$h1Hl$LL$ )D$LD$H)D$ )D$0)D$@)D$P\$H|$ Dd$ |Ht$ 1PIHthH0HcH6HH|$ D~M1(fDtst~ADD!‰HHH;t$ }!LT$M 2uADDE1H|$tHHD$hdH3%(uZHxL[]A\A]ADf@AT2AT2A DpPX~ff.AWfHHAVH=AUE1ATUSHdH%(H$1Hl$0LL$()D$0LD$H)D$@)D$P)D$`)D$p$\$H|$@Ld$(L;%l ID$1HL$$HT$ LH5r?UD$ =|$$X~HD$@ 1HcHHHDIHnH HcT$$H=D@H|$@LE1fE1E1AJf7>9tAEE9ALI9ǃu@E1H|$tH蝿HD$hdH3%(FHpL[]A\A]A^f1I@~~I91fIvEA9A)fI*XLAAAI9'1EtfA*^H,DDAAAAfE)I*Xb>>nff.AVfHHAUHATUSHpdH%(HD$h1Hl$LD$ )D$H)D$ )D$0)D$@)D$P$\$ H|$ L\$ LcM9Ht$DL1E1E1AHDD9tAEE9ALI9Auf.E1H|$tHHD$hdH3%(HpL[]A\A]A^f1II@DFDDFAAA1I9{Iv$EtKEEE)E)E9EMOD9IBAfDDDAEAD\f.DD ff.fATfHHUHd SHpdH%(HD$h1Hl$LD$ )D$H)D$ )D$0)D$@)D$Pȼ\$ H|$ 谽LL$ M~fHL$Lc11"t+t.1)9HBLLL9}>u@AA1fD˻IH|$tHȺHD$hdH3%(uHpL[]A\@E1κff.ATH=FUH4HtOHI蔻HHt<11H= ܺH}JHHtH5 HHL]A\E1HL]A\HHSize should be 1, 2, 3 or 4not a whole number of framesy*i:byteswapy*i:reversey*ii:lin2liny*i:lin2alawy*i:alaw2liny*i:lin2ulawy*i:ulaw2liny*ii:biasy*iO:lin2adpcmstate must be a tuple or Nonebad state(O(ii))y*iO:adpcm2liny*y*:findfitStrings should be even-sizedFirst sample should be longer(nf)y*i:minmax(ii)y*iiiiO|ii:ratecv# of channels should be >= 1sampling rate not > 0illegal state argument(O(iO))y*in:getsampleIndex out of rangey*idd:tostereoy*idd:tomonoy*y*i:addLengths should be the samey*id:muly*i:avgy*i:crossy*n:findmaxInput sample should be longery*y*:findfactorSamples should be same sizey*i:rmsy*i:avgppy*i:maxppy*i:maxaudioop.erroraudioopnot enough memory for output bufferii;lin2adpcm(): illegal state argumentii;adpcm2lin(): illegal state argumentwidth * nchannels too big for a C intweightA should be >= 1, weightB should be >= 0iO!;ratecv(): illegal state argumentratecv(): illegal state argumentii;ratecv(): illegal state argument "%)-27<BIPXakv3Qs Vl$V LLT!%(,[1K6;ADH~OqW/`ibt@@@@@@@@˨(8hxHX(8hxHX ` ` ` `Pp0Pp0 @ @ @ @ @@ @ @ VR^ZFBNJvr~zfbnj+)/-#!'%;9?=3175XHxh8(XHxh8(` ` ` ` 0pP0pPÄńDŽɄ˄̈́τфӄՄׄلۄ݄DDDDDDDD$d$d$d$d4Tt4Tt ,|<|:|8|6|4|2|0|.|,|*|(|&|$|"| << < < < < < <\\\\lL, lL, tdTD4$xph`XPH@80( ???0C;  (@PPh0`@@PP0 0pL@ @ P @8zRx $pFJ w?:*3$"D\tDY0 bADJ [ AAD mCA0\$FKH D  DABA <XFLH A(D (D ABBH L47FLI B(A0A8D 8D0A(B BBBH <FLH A(D\ (D ABBD <xFLH A(D6 (D ABBB <FLH A(D` (D ABBH <DFLH A(D6 (D ABBB <FLH A(D (D ABBH LXFLI E(A0A8G 8D0A(B BBBE LFLI E(A0A8G 8D0A(B BBBE 4d_FLK G  DBBE 4ZFKH D#  DABI hFLI B(A0C8G_CFIII[ 8D0A(B BBBH 0@HFKH D  DABG \tFLI B(A0A8Ga]RA 8D0A(B BBBB \8FLI B(A0A8GafRAs 8D0A(B BBBH L4FLI B(A0A8G 8D0A(B BBBG L(FFLI B(A0A8G 8D0A(B BBBB 4(FKH D  DABB 4 RFKH D  DABE ,D(FKN= DBF 4tFLK GC  DBBA 4 FKH D"  DABJ DFLI A(A0D* 0D(A BBBJ D,SFLI A(A0D* 0D(A BBBJ 0t2FKH D  DABE 0$~FMD O DBD GDB$#u go  X  o oo oS0 @ P ` p !! !0!@!P!`!p!!!!!adpcm2lin($module, fragment, width, state, /) -- Decode an Intel/DVI ADPCM coded fragment to a linear fragment.lin2adpcm($module, fragment, width, state, /) -- Convert samples to 4 bit Intel/DVI ADPCM encoding.alaw2lin($module, fragment, width, /) -- Convert sound fragments in a-LAW encoding to linearly encoded sound fragments.lin2alaw($module, fragment, width, /) -- Convert samples in the audio fragment to a-LAW encoding.ulaw2lin($module, fragment, width, /) -- Convert sound fragments in u-LAW encoding to linearly encoded sound fragments.lin2ulaw($module, fragment, width, /) -- Convert samples in the audio fragment to u-LAW encoding.ratecv($module, fragment, width, nchannels, inrate, outrate, state, weightA=1, weightB=0, /) -- Convert the frame rate of the input fragment.lin2lin($module, fragment, width, newwidth, /) -- Convert samples between 1-, 2-, 3- and 4-byte formats.byteswap($module, fragment, width, /) -- Convert big-endian samples to little-endian and vice versa.reverse($module, fragment, width, /) -- Reverse the samples in a fragment and returns the modified fragment.bias($module, fragment, width, bias, /) -- Return a fragment that is the original fragment with a bias added to each sample.add($module, fragment1, fragment2, width, /) -- Return a fragment which is the addition of the two samples passed as parameters.tostereo($module, fragment, width, lfactor, rfactor, /) -- Generate a stereo fragment from a mono fragment.tomono($module, fragment, width, lfactor, rfactor, /) -- Convert a stereo fragment to a mono fragment.mul($module, fragment, width, factor, /) -- Return a fragment that has all samples in the original fragment multiplied by the floating-point value factor.cross($module, fragment, width, /) -- Return the number of zero crossings in the fragment passed as an argument.maxpp($module, fragment, width, /) -- Return the maximum peak-peak value in the sound fragment.avgpp($module, fragment, width, /) -- Return the average peak-peak value over all samples in the fragment.findmax($module, fragment, length, /) -- Search fragment for a slice of specified number of samples with maximum energy.findfactor($module, fragment, reference, /) -- Return a factor F such that rms(add(fragment, mul(reference, -F))) is minimal.findfit($module, fragment, reference, /) -- Try to match reference as well as possible to a portion of fragment.rms($module, fragment, width, /) -- Return the root-mean-square of the fragment, i.e. sqrt(sum(S_i^2)/n).avg($module, fragment, width, /) -- Return the average over all samples in the fragment.minmax($module, fragment, width, /) -- Return the minimum and maximum values of all samples in the sound fragment.max($module, fragment, width, /) -- Return the maximum of the absolute value of all samples in a fragment.getsample($module, fragment, width, index, /) -- Return the value of sample index from the fragment.rr f@rX`rc`r ar`_p:`.r\`Yr]$rZr@U@qPRp 1 pp/}p-pp+cp)Wp'p6p2qMqI@qpHJp%=p$ Sqp?62d658f024ed21b7234b7f7beef7a25fe6f841.debug2 m.shstrtab.note.gnu.property.note.gnu.build-id.gnu.hash.dynsym.dynstr.gnu.version.gnu.version_r.rela.dyn.rela.plt.init.plt.got.plt.sec.text.fini.rodata.eh_frame_hdr.eh_frame.init_array.fini_array.dynamic.got.plt.data.bss.gnu_debuglink  $1o$; xCKo JXo Pg qBX{ v !!!!`#`#~Dgg pp zz {{P@   4T